Understanding Indoor Air Quality

Indoor Air Quality refers to the cleanliness and safety of the air inside buildings and structures. Good IAQ means that the air is free from pollutants and contaminants that can harm occupants. Factors influencing IAQ include:

  • Ventilation: Proper airflow is essential for diluting and removing indoor pollutants.
  • Source Control: Identifying and minimizing the sources of pollution within the home.
  • Air Purification: Using devices and systems to remove contaminants from the air.
  • Humidity Levels: Maintaining optimal humidity to prevent mold growth and dust mites.

Achieving excellent IAQ involves a combination of these factors, tailored to the specific needs and conditions of each living space.

Common Indoor Pollutants

Several pollutants can degrade indoor air quality, each posing unique health risks:

  • Dust Mites: Microscopic organisms that thrive in warm, humid environments, feeding on dead skin cells.
  • Pet Dander: Tiny flakes of skin shed by pets, which can become airborne and cause allergic reactions.
  • Mold Spores: Fungi that grow in damp areas, releasing spores into the air that can trigger respiratory issues.
  • Pollen: Outdoor pollen can infiltrate indoor spaces, especially during spring and summer months.
  • Volatile Organic Compounds (VOCs):strong> Chemicals found in paints, cleaning products, and furnishings that can cause headaches and respiratory irritation.
  • Smoke Particles: Smoke from cooking, candles, or fireplaces can degrade air quality and cause irritation.
  • Carbon Monoxide: A colorless, odorless gas produced by burning fuels, posing serious health risks if not detected.

Identifying these pollutants is the first step in mitigating their impact and improving the air quality in your home.

Solutions for Improving Indoor Air Quality

Enhancing indoor air quality involves a combination of strategies aimed at reducing pollutants and promoting clean air circulation. Here are effective solutions to achieve healthier living spaces:

Ventilation Improvements

Proper ventilation is crucial for maintaining good IAQ by ensuring a constant supply of fresh air and removing stale, polluted air. Key ventilation strategies include:

  • Natural Ventilation: Opening windows and doors to allow fresh air to circulate, especially during activities that generate pollutants.
  • Mechanical Ventilation: Installing exhaust fans in kitchens, bathrooms, and other high-pollution areas to actively remove contaminants.
  • Whole-House Ventilation Systems: Utilizing systems like Energy Recovery Ventilators (ERVs) or Heat Recovery Ventilators (HRVs) to exchange indoor air with outdoor air efficiently.

Enhancing ventilation not only improves air quality but also contributes to energy efficiency by balancing indoor temperatures and reducing humidity levels.

Air Purification Systems

Air purifiers play a vital role in removing airborne pollutants, providing cleaner and healthier indoor air. There are various types of air purification systems, each with its unique benefits:

  • HEPA Filters: High-Efficiency Particulate Air (HEPA) filters can capture up to 99.97% of particles as small as 0.3 microns, including dust, pollen, and pet dander.
  • Activated Carbon Filters: These filters are effective in removing odors, smoke, and VOCs from the air, enhancing overall air quality.
  • UV Light Purifiers: Ultraviolet (UV) light can kill bacteria, viruses, and mold spores, preventing their spread throughout the home.
  • Ionizers: Ionizers release negative ions that attach to airborne particles, causing them to settle out of the air or be captured by surfaces.

Integrating air purification systems with your HVAC can provide continuous filtration, ensuring that the air circulated throughout your home remains clean and free from harmful pollutants.

Humidity Control

Maintaining optimal humidity levels is essential for preventing the growth of mold and dust mites, both of which thrive in high humidity environments. Effective humidity control strategies include:

  • Dehumidifiers: These devices remove excess moisture from the air, creating an environment less conducive to mold and dust mites.
  • Humidifiers: In dry climates or during winter months, humidifiers add moisture to the air, preventing dry skin and respiratory irritation.
  • HVAC Integration: Many modern HVAC systems come equipped with built-in humidifiers and dehumidifiers for seamless humidity management.
  • Ventilation: Proper ventilation helps regulate indoor humidity by facilitating the exchange of moist indoor air with drier outdoor air.

Balancing humidity levels not only improves comfort but also enhances the effectiveness of other IAQ solutions by creating an environment that discourages allergen proliferation.

Regular Maintenance and Cleaning

Routine maintenance and cleaning of your HVAC system are crucial for sustaining good indoor air quality. Key maintenance practices include:

  • Filter Replacement: Regularly changing or cleaning air filters prevents them from becoming clogged, ensuring optimal airflow and maximum filtration efficiency.
  • System Inspections: Periodic inspections by professional technicians can identify and address issues such as leaks, worn-out components, and mold growth before they escalate.
  • Coil Cleaning: Cleaning the evaporator and condenser coils removes dust and debris, enhancing heat exchange and system performance.
  • Duct Cleaning: Regularly cleaning air ducts eliminates accumulated dust, mold, and other contaminants, preventing their circulation throughout the home.
  • Seal Leaks: Ensuring that ductwork is properly sealed prevents the loss of conditioned air and the intrusion of outdoor pollutants.

Implementing a regular maintenance schedule not only preserves indoor air quality but also extends the lifespan of your HVAC system, ensuring reliable performance and energy efficiency.

Use of Low-VOC Products

Volatile Organic Compounds (VOCs) are chemicals found in many household products that can degrade indoor air quality. Minimizing VOC exposure involves selecting low-VOC or VOC-free products, including:

  • Paints and Finishes: Choose paints, varnishes, and finishes labeled as low-VOC or no-VOC to reduce harmful emissions.
  • Cleaning Products: Opt for eco-friendly cleaning agents that are free from harsh chemicals and fragrances.
  • Furniture and Upholstery: Select furniture made from natural materials and finishes that emit fewer VOCs.
  • Building Materials: Use low-VOC insulation, flooring, and cabinetry to minimize indoor pollutant sources.

By incorporating low-VOC products into your home, you can significantly reduce the presence of harmful chemicals in the air, promoting a healthier living environment.

Indoor Plants

Indoor plants are a natural and aesthetically pleasing way to improve indoor air quality. They offer several benefits, including:

  • Air Purification: Plants absorb carbon dioxide and release oxygen, enhancing the overall air quality. Certain plants, like spider plants and peace lilies, are particularly effective at removing toxins such as formaldehyde and benzene.
  • Humidity Regulation: Through the process of transpiration, plants release moisture into the air, helping to maintain optimal humidity levels.
  • Mood Enhancement: The presence of greenery can reduce stress and improve mental well-being, contributing to a more pleasant living environment.
  • Natural Aesthetics: Plants add a touch of nature to your home, enhancing its visual appeal and creating a more inviting atmosphere.

Incorporating indoor plants is an easy and cost-effective way to naturally enhance indoor air quality and create a healthier living space.

Proper Ventilation During Activities

Certain household activities can significantly impact indoor air quality. Ensuring proper ventilation during and after these activities helps mitigate pollutant buildup:

  • Cooking: Use exhaust fans or open windows while cooking to remove smoke, odors, and particulate matter.
  • Cleaning: Ventilate the area when using cleaning products to disperse fumes and prevent the accumulation of VOCs.
  • Smoking: Smoke outside or in well-ventilated areas to avoid contaminating indoor air.
  • Painting and Renovation: Ensure adequate ventilation when painting or performing renovations to eliminate harmful fumes and dust.
  • Using Candles and Incense: Limit the use of candles and incense, and ensure the room is well-ventilated to prevent excessive soot and fragrance buildup.

Implementing these ventilation practices during indoor activities helps maintain a cleaner and healthier indoor environment.

Frequently Asked Questions

  1. What is Indoor Air Quality (IAQ)?

    Indoor Air Quality refers to the cleanliness and safety of the air inside buildings and structures. Good IAQ means that the air is free from pollutants and contaminants that can harm occupants.

  2. Why is indoor air quality important?

    Good indoor air quality is essential for health and well-being. Poor IAQ can lead to respiratory issues, allergies, headaches, and other health problems. It also affects productivity and overall comfort.

  3. What are the common sources of indoor air pollution?

    Common sources include dust mites, pet dander, mold spores, pollen, VOCs from paints and cleaning products, smoke particles, and combustion by-products like carbon monoxide.

  4. How can ventilation improve indoor air quality?

    Proper ventilation ensures a constant supply of fresh air and the removal of stale, polluted air. It helps dilute indoor pollutants and maintain balanced humidity levels, reducing the concentration of harmful substances.

  5. What role do air purifiers play in improving IAQ?

    Air purifiers remove airborne contaminants such as dust, pollen, pet dander, and mold spores. Advanced systems like HEPA filters and activated carbon filters can significantly enhance indoor air quality by trapping and eliminating these pollutants.

  6. How does humidity control affect indoor air quality?

    Maintaining optimal humidity levels (30-50%) prevents the growth of mold and dust mites, which thrive in high humidity environments. Proper humidity control also reduces respiratory irritation and enhances overall comfort.

  7. Can regular HVAC maintenance improve IAQ?

    Yes, regular HVAC maintenance ensures that the system operates efficiently and effectively in filtering and circulating clean air. It includes tasks like filter replacement, system inspections, and cleaning components to prevent pollutant buildup.

  8. What are VOCs, and how do they impact IAQ?

    Volatile Organic Compounds (VOCs) are chemicals found in many household products like paints, cleaning agents, and furnishings. They can cause headaches, respiratory irritation, and other health issues when present in high concentrations.

  9. Are there any natural ways to improve indoor air quality?

    Yes, using indoor plants, ensuring proper ventilation, regularly cleaning and dusting, and minimizing the use of products that emit VOCs are natural ways to enhance indoor air quality.

  10. How can smart home technology help improve IAQ?

    Smart home technologies like smart thermostats, air quality sensors, and automated ventilation systems can monitor and adjust indoor conditions in real-time, ensuring optimal air quality and energy efficiency.

  11. What is the relationship between IAQ and energy efficiency?

    Improving IAQ often involves optimizing HVAC systems, which can enhance energy efficiency. Efficient systems use less energy while maintaining clean and comfortable indoor environments.

  12. How often should air ducts be cleaned to maintain good IAQ?

    It is recommended to have air ducts cleaned every 3-5 years, or more frequently if you have pets, suffer from allergies, or notice visible mold growth or excessive dust buildup.

  13. Can indoor air quality affect my health?

    Yes, poor indoor air quality can lead to a range of health issues, including respiratory problems, allergies, headaches, fatigue, and in severe cases, long-term chronic conditions.

  14. What are some signs that my indoor air quality is poor?

    Signs include persistent allergy symptoms, frequent headaches, unusual odors, visible mold growth, excessive dust buildup, and noticeable moisture or condensation in the home.

  15. How can I test the indoor air quality in my home?

    Indoor air quality can be tested using DIY kits available at home improvement stores or by hiring professional services that provide comprehensive air quality assessments.

  16. What are the benefits of professional air duct cleaning?

    Professional air duct cleaning removes accumulated dust, mold, and other contaminants from your ductwork, improving air quality, enhancing system efficiency, and extending the lifespan of your HVAC system.

  17. Are there any government standards for indoor air quality?

    Yes, organizations like the Environmental Protection Agency (EPA) provide guidelines and standards for indoor air quality, including recommended pollutant levels and best practices for maintaining clean air.

  18. Can improving IAQ reduce energy bills?

    Yes, optimizing HVAC systems for IAQ can enhance energy efficiency, leading to lower energy consumption and reduced utility bills over time.

  19. What products should I avoid to maintain good IAQ?

    Avoid products that emit high levels of VOCs, such as certain paints, air fresheners, cleaning agents, and furniture with synthetic materials. Opt for eco-friendly and low-VOC alternatives instead.

  20. How do indoor plants improve air quality?

    Indoor plants absorb carbon dioxide and release oxygen through photosynthesis. Certain plants can also filter out toxins and pollutants, contributing to cleaner indoor air.

  21. Can regular cleaning help improve IAQ?

    Absolutely. Regular cleaning reduces dust, pet dander, and other allergens. Vacuuming with a HEPA-filtered vacuum, dusting surfaces, and keeping the home clutter-free are effective ways to maintain good IAQ.
